读书人

运用sax解析网上xml(一个rss地址)

发布时间: 2013-04-21 21:18:07 作者: rapoo

使用sax解析网上xml(一个rss地址),获取的内容乱码
使用sax解析网上的一个xml,如果源文件编码是utf-8,那么解析的时候用utf-8解析出来不会乱码,
但如果源文件编码是gb2312的,这样就会有乱码,求解决的方法
[解决办法]
编码转换
String str;//gb2312编码字符串
String strGB = new String(str.getBytes(),"GB2312");
String strUTF = new String(strGB.getBytes(),"UTF-8");

试试吧!

读书人网 >Android

热点推荐